Hunter’s are pretty much the only class who’s only job is to put out DPS. They just sit back and throw shots after shots without stopping, and whenever you get aggro you just to Feign Death or Disengage, and you’re good to throw out some more shots. So the amount of DPS you put out determines whether you’re a good Hunter, or one of the many decent hunters.
A good Hunter PvE guide will focus mostly on the numbers you put out. It will show you where to get your gear, what stats to work on, which is Agility and Attack Power by the way.
Once you get that out of the way, the guide should show you what type of consumables to take and what buffs to ask from your party members. It should also go through your shot rotations and how to spec your Hunter properly. Right now the best build is Marksman, but some people still go Beastmastery to counter the mana problem that Marksman has.
